Experienced Distributed Systems Engineer – Data Platform Development and Operations (Part Time/Remote) at Netflix
Introduction to Netflix and Our Mission
At Netflix, we are pioneering the future of entertainment, continuously enhancing how content is imagined, created, and delivered to a global audience. With over 220 million paid subscribers in 190 countries, we are not only a leader in the entertainment industry but also a driving force in innovation and technology. Our mission is to entertain the world, and we are committed to making a positive impact on the lives of our members. As a leader in the digital entertainment space, we are always looking for talented individuals to join our team and contribute to our success.
About the Role
We are seeking an experienced Distributed Systems Engineer to join our Data Platform team. As a key member of our team, you will play a critical role in designing, developing, and operating our distributed systems infrastructure. Your expertise will help us drive business growth, improve our services, and enhance the overall user experience. This is a part-time, remote opportunity, offering you the flexibility to work from anywhere in the United States.
Key Responsibilities
- Design, develop, and operate large-scale distributed systems, focusing on scalability, reliability, and performance
- Collaborate with cross-functional teams, including engineering, product management, and technical program management, to drive business outcomes
- Architect and build powerful, versatile, and highly available distributed infrastructure
- Drive technical initiatives and contribute to the development of our open-source software
- Participate in the design and development of Tranquil web services, ensuring seamless integration with our existing systems
- Work closely with our engineering teams to build and operate fault-tolerant, distributed systems
- Contribute to the development of our data platform, enabling our teams to make data-driven decisions
Essential Qualifications
- 2+ years of experience in building large-scale distributed systems or applications
- Proficiency in the design and development of Tranquil web services
- Experience in building and operating scalable, fault-tolerant, distributed systems
- Strong programming skills in Java or other object-oriented programming languages
- BS in Computer Science or a related field
- Excellent communication and collaboration skills, with the ability to work effectively in a remote environment
Preferred Qualifications
- Experience with cloud-native technologies and distributed data processing
- Knowledge of open-source software and contribution to open-source communities
- Familiarity with Python and other programming languages
- Experience with event-driven and serverless architectures
- Strong understanding of computer systems, networking, and software engineering principles
Skills and Competencies
To be successful in this role, you will need to possess a unique combination of technical, business, and interpersonal skills. Some of the key skills and competencies we are looking for include:
- Strong technical expertise in distributed systems, software engineering, and data processing
- Excellent problem-solving skills, with the ability to analyze complex problems and develop creative solutions
- Strong communication and collaboration skills, with the ability to work effectively with cross-functional teams
- Ability to drive technical initiatives and contribute to the development of our open-source software
- Strong understanding of business outcomes and the ability to drive technical decisions that support our business goals
Career Growth Opportunities and Learning Benefits
At Netflix, we are committed to the growth and development of our employees. As a Distributed Systems Engineer, you will have the opportunity to work on complex and challenging projects, develop new skills, and contribute to the development of our open-source software. You will also have access to a wide range of training and development programs, including:
- Technical training and certification programs
- Leadership development programs
- Mentorship and coaching opportunities
- Access to industry conferences and events
Work Environment and Company Culture
At Netflix, we are proud of our unique and dynamic company culture. We are a collaborative and innovative organization, with a strong focus on teamwork, creativity, and mutual respect. Our employees are passionate about their work, and we are committed to providing a work environment that is supportive, inclusive, and fun. Some of the benefits of working at Netflix include:
- Flexible working hours and remote work options
- Comprehensive health and wellness programs
- Generous paid time off and holiday policies
- Access to cutting-edge technology and tools
- Opportunities for professional growth and development
Compensation, Perks, and Benefits
We offer a competitive compensation package, including a salary range of $26 per hour, as well as a wide range of perks and benefits, including:
- Comprehensive health insurance
- 401(k) matching program
- Stock options and equity incentives
- Flexible spending accounts
- Employee discounts and rewards programs
Conclusion
If you are a motivated and talented Distributed Systems Engineer, looking for a new challenge and opportunity to make a real impact, we encourage you to apply for this role. At Netflix, we are committed to innovation, creativity, and excellence, and we are looking for individuals who share our passion and values. Don't miss this opportunity to join our team and contribute to the future of entertainment.
Submit Your Application
Seize this opportunity to make a significant impact. Apply now and take the first step towards a rewarding new role.
Apply To This Job Apply for this job